Bathroom Sink Replacement Questions
What are common reasons to replace a bathroom sink? Signs like leaks, cracks, or outdated fixtures often indicate the need for replacement to improve function and appearance.
Can a bathroom sink be replaced without major renovations? Yes, many sink replacements can be completed without extensive remodeling, especially when choosing similar styles and sizes.
What types of bathroom sinks are available for replacement? Options include pedestal, vanity, undermount, and vessel sinks, allowing for customization based on style and space.
Is it necessary to shut off water supply for sink replacement? Yes, shutting off the water supply is essential to prevent leaks and water damage during the replacement process.
